P lease join Green Energy Consumers Alliance and John Motta, part of the engineering team at the Narragansett Bay Commission, for a tour of a wind turbine that supplies power to Rhode Island's Community Choice Electricity program in Barrington, Central Falls, Narragansett, Newport, Providence, Portsmouth, and South Kingstown. We're a non-profit that enables people to make green energy choices in the most cost-effective and seamless ways and advocate for progressive energy policies. Through consumer voices & choices, we aim to speed the transition to a zero-carbon future.
